The Imperial Hotel
Local business
WC1B 5JS London
United Kingdom
Phone: +44 (0) 20 7837 3655
Website: http://www.imperialhotels.co.uk/imperial
Local business
Phone: +44 (0) 20 7837 3655
Website: http://www.imperialhotels.co.uk/imperial